BUG: KCSAN: data-race in wg_socket_send_skb_to_peer / wg_socket_send_skb_to_peer
read-write to 0xffff88811af99028 of 8 bytes by task 310 on cpu 1:
wg_socket_send_skb_to_peer+0xe8/0x130 drivers/net/wireguard/socket.c:182
wg_socket_send_buffer_to_peer+0xf1/0x120 drivers/net/wireguard/socket.c:199
wg_packet_send_handshake_initiation drivers/net/wireguard/send.c:40 [inline]
wg_packet_handshake_send_worker+0x10d/0x160 drivers/net/wireguard/send.c:51
process_one_work kernel/workqueue.c:3314 [inline]
process_scheduled_works+0x4f0/0x9c0 kernel/workqueue.c:3397
worker_thread+0x58a/0x780 kernel/workqueue.c:3478
kthread+0x22a/0x280 kernel/kthread.c:436
ret_from_fork+0x146/0x330 arch/x86/kernel/process.c:158
ret_from_fork_asm+0x1a/0x30 arch/x86/entry/entry_64.S:245
read-write to 0xffff88811af99028 of 8 bytes by task 15360 on cpu 0:
wg_socket_send_skb_to_peer+0xe8/0x130 drivers/net/wireguard/socket.c:182
wg_packet_create_data_done drivers/net/wireguard/send.c:251 [inline]
wg_packet_tx_worker+0x12d/0x330 drivers/net/wireguard/send.c:276
process_one_work kernel/workqueue.c:3314 [inline]
process_scheduled_works+0x4f0/0x9c0 kernel/workqueue.c:3397
worker_thread+0x58a/0x780 kernel/workqueue.c:3478
kthread+0x22a/0x280 kernel/kthread.c:436
ret_from_fork+0x146/0x330 arch/x86/kernel/process.c:158
ret_from_fork_asm+0x1a/0x30 arch/x86/entry/entry_64.S:245
value changed: 0x0000000000000a2c -> 0x0000000000000ac0
Reported by Kernel Concurrency Sanitizer on:
CPU: 0 UID: 0 PID: 15360 Comm: kworker/0:2 Tainted: G W syzkaller #0 PREEMPT(lazy)
Tainted: [W]=WARN
Hardware name: Google Google Compute Engine/Google Compute Engine, BIOS Google 04/18/2026
Workqueue: wg-crypt-wg2 wg_packet_tx_worker
